Sažetak
A single metamerism index does not give enough information about the metameric properties of colours, and the colour difference DE is not sufficient to describe their varieties. For this reason, a procedure is suggested that describes metamerism in more detail with the following three parameters: 1. The colour temperature (or interval of colour temperature) of the light source (Planck radiator) for which the chromaticity difference between of the metameric colours is a minimum (the balancing colour temperature Tm or DTm). 2. The colour difference at Tm(DTm). 3. The chromaticity change in a determined chosen interval of the colour temperature which contains Tm (Dc 1000, Dc500 or otherwise). To estimate these parameters, the most suitable procedure is to determine the coordinates of two metameric colours for a series of colour temperatures in the CIE 1976 system (e.g. 2000K, 3000K … 9000K, 10000K). For each colour temperature the differences Du' and Dv' are calculated and plotted in the coordinate system with axes Du' and Dv'. The curve is obtained, from which Tm (or DTm), Dc and DEm are calculated in the usual way. Several examples of this process with the corresponding discussion are given. Because this process can be performed for any two colours, the conditions which DEm and Dc must fulfil in order for these two colours to be considered metameric must be established.
